the Memorial Tournament presented by Workday
About
The Memorial Tournament presented by Workday is an elite PGA Tour event established in 1976 by Jack Nicklaus. It is held annually at Muirfield Village Golf Club in Dublin, Ohio, a par-72 course measuring 7,569 yards, designed by Nicklaus himself. The tournament features a limited field of approximately 72 to 73 players, as it holds "invitational" status, which allows for more selective entry criteria than regular open PGA Tour events. Players compete over four rounds (72 holes) of stroke play with a 36-hole cut to the top 50 players plus ties and those within 10 strokes of the lead. Qualification is mainly based on invitations extended to recent winners of significant tournaments, PGA Tour members with notable achievements, major championship winners, Ryder Cup players, and sponsor exemptions; there is no open qualifying. The winner of the tournament receives a three-year PGA Tour exemption, a higher status than most standard tour events.
